The En Sound Music Awards Honoring Indie Christian And Gospel Artists Comes To Atlanta, July 29, 2012

Metro Atlanta continues to become a hub for top music events.  En Sound Entertainment has announced the 2012 En Sound Music Awards, recognizing the talent of indie Christian and gospel artists around the world, will be held at the Porter Sanford III Performing Arts Center in the city of Decatur, Ga., a suburb of metro Atlanta.  The show will take place on Sunday, July 29, 2012 at 5:30p.m., and it promises to be an evening packed with great performances and surprises.

 

Awards will be presented in 21 categories this year, with Atlanta’s Delra Harris leading the nominations with nine nods and South Africa’s Martin PK with eight nods including Male Vocalist of the Year, Song of the Year, Artist of the Year and Album of the Year.  Harris will perform during the awards ceremony along with other nominees including Terea (NJ), C Sharp (South Africa), Andre Byrd (NY), Saxophonist Courtney Fadlin (JAM), Deanna Ransom (DE), Necie B. (LA), C.R.A.E.M (Bahamas), Chiquita Green (PA)…

 

“We are truly excited to bring the En Sound Music Awards to Atlanta this year,” said Delroy Souden, founder of En Sound Entertainment, producer of the En Sound Music Awards, and indie gospel recording artist himself.  “This awards show offers a platform for some of the finest indie Christian and gospel artists to be recognized, and to introduce music lovers to these incredibly talented artists.” Souden founded the En Sound Music Awards in 2006.  Since its inception, the show has created a buzz on all continents and has become one of the most talked-about events of its kind.

 

This year, the event will be hosted by Gerard Henry, formerly of BET’s “Lift Every Voice.”  Henry states, “I am always honored to be a part of special events that not only honors but identifies the Hidden Treasures within the body of Christ.  Music is an integral part of our daily experience and these artists have purposed to offer their gifts to enhance our experience with God. That must be celebrated!”

 

Nominee requirements for the En Sound Music Awards include, but not limited to artist visibility on the web; Internet/Terrestrial radio; press releases; blogs; interviews; album reviews; television appearances; and performance schedules. Nominees must also become a member of the Christian Internet Radio Association (www.1cira.org), membership is free. Award-winners have been determined by public votes online.
